Formatting
[jalview.git] / src / jalview / jbgui / GPCAPanel.java
index 19d184b..5c17ba7 100755 (executable)
@@ -1,6 +1,6 @@
 /*\r
  * Jalview - A Sequence Alignment Editor and Viewer\r
- * Copyright (C) 2005 AM Waterhouse, J Procter, G Barton, M Clamp, S Searle\r
+ * Copyright (C) 2007 AM Waterhouse, J Procter, G Barton, M Clamp, S Searle\r
  *\r
  * This program is free software; you can redistribute it and/or\r
  * modify it under the terms of the GNU General Public License\r
@@ -21,6 +21,7 @@ package jalview.jbgui;
 import java.awt.*;\r
 import java.awt.event.*;\r
 import javax.swing.*;\r
+import javax.swing.event.*;\r
 \r
 public class GPCAPanel\r
     extends JInternalFrame\r
@@ -41,10 +42,11 @@ public class GPCAPanel
   JMenuItem png = new JMenuItem();\r
   JMenuItem print = new JMenuItem();\r
   JMenuItem outputValues = new JMenuItem();\r
-  JMenu viewMenu = new JMenu();\r
+  protected JMenu viewMenu = new JMenu();\r
   protected JCheckBoxMenuItem showLabels = new JCheckBoxMenuItem();\r
   JMenuItem bgcolour = new JMenuItem();\r
   JMenuItem originalSeqData = new JMenuItem();\r
+  protected JMenu associateViewsMenu = new JMenu();\r
 \r
   public GPCAPanel()\r
   {\r
@@ -64,7 +66,6 @@ public class GPCAPanel
       zCombobox.addItem("dim " + i);\r
     }\r
 \r
-\r
     setJMenuBar(jMenuBar1);\r
   }\r
 \r
@@ -139,6 +140,21 @@ public class GPCAPanel
       }\r
     });\r
     viewMenu.setText("View");\r
+    viewMenu.addMenuListener(new MenuListener()\r
+    {\r
+      public void menuSelected(MenuEvent e)\r
+      {\r
+        viewMenu_menuSelected();\r
+      }\r
+\r
+      public void menuDeselected(MenuEvent e)\r
+      {\r
+      }\r
+\r
+      public void menuCanceled(MenuEvent e)\r
+      {\r
+      }\r
+    });\r
     showLabels.setText("Show Labels");\r
     showLabels.addActionListener(new ActionListener()\r
     {\r
@@ -164,6 +180,7 @@ public class GPCAPanel
         originalSeqData_actionPerformed(e);\r
       }\r
     });\r
+    associateViewsMenu.setText("Associate Nodes With");\r
     this.getContentPane().add(jPanel2, BorderLayout.SOUTH);\r
     jPanel2.add(jLabel1, null);\r
     jPanel2.add(xCombobox, null);\r
@@ -181,6 +198,7 @@ public class GPCAPanel
     saveMenu.add(png);\r
     viewMenu.add(showLabels);\r
     viewMenu.add(bgcolour);\r
+    viewMenu.add(associateViewsMenu);\r
   }\r
 \r
   protected void xCombobox_actionPerformed(ActionEvent e)\r
@@ -229,4 +247,9 @@ public class GPCAPanel
   {\r
 \r
   }\r
+\r
+  public void viewMenu_menuSelected()\r
+  {\r
+\r
+  }\r
 }\r